I truly don’t think this is an issue this time, because Rep. Carl Wimmer, is perhaps Utah’s biggest 10th Amendment advocate and about as pro gun rights as they’ve got.

“More than 250,000 people have sought a Utah permit since it began issuing them in 1995, though, especially in recent years, most have been issued to people living outside Utah because its permit is honored in 32 states.”

That is, Utah has essentially been “exporting” permits, with citizens of other States traveling to Utah to get gun permits that would be recognized in their home State.

http://www.ehow.com/how_4818288_utah-carry-permit-valid-states.html

“To get a concealed firearm permit from Utah you do not need to be a Utah resident.”
